Energy Savings of Warehouse Lighting in LED
Switching to LED lighting in warehouses can lead to significant energy savings. The following table outlines different types of warehouse lighting fixtures, their typical applications, mounting heights, and the energy savings percentage achieved by upgrading to LED.
Lighting Fixture | Application | Typical Mounting Height | Energy Savings (%) |
---|---|---|---|
High Bay Lights | Large open areas | 15-40 feet | 60% |
Low Bay Lights | Smaller spaces | 12-20 feet | 50% |
LED Strip Lights | Aisles and shelving | 8-15 feet | 55% |
Flood Lights | Outdoor areas | Variable | 65% |
By choosing the right LED fixtures, warehouse operators in Kewanee can optimize their lighting systems for both performance and cost-effectiveness. The energy savings not only contribute to lower utility bills but also support sustainability initiatives.
Every Warehouse in Kewanee city, Illinois is Different
Understanding the existing lighting setup is crucial when planning an upgrade to LED lighting in any warehouse. Each facility in Kewanee may have different types of lighting fixtures, models, wattage, and input voltage. Conducting a thorough assessment of these elements is the first step in the upgrade process.
Warehouse dimensions and the nature of operations also play a significant role in determining the appropriate lighting solutions. For instance, a warehouse with high ceilings may require high bay lights, while a facility with lower ceilings might benefit from low bay or strip lights. Additionally, knowing the input voltage is essential to ensure compatibility with new LED fixtures.
Identifying the major operations within the warehouse, such as storage, packaging, or manufacturing, can help tailor the lighting design to meet specific needs. Proper lighting enhances visibility, safety, and productivity, making it a vital component of warehouse operations.
Other Considerations for Kewanee city, Illinois
When selecting lighting fixtures for warehouses in Kewanee, it’s important to consider local climate-specific conditions. The region’s weather patterns may influence the choice of fixtures, particularly for outdoor lighting. For example, fixtures with higher IP ratings may be necessary to withstand moisture and temperature fluctuations.
Local codes and utility rebates can also impact the selection of lighting controls. In Kewanee, incorporating lighting controls such as daylight sensors and motion sensor controls can enhance energy efficiency and may be required to qualify for certain rebates. These controls adjust lighting levels based on occupancy and natural light availability, further reducing energy consumption and costs.
Implementing these advanced lighting controls not only aligns with local regulations but also provides additional benefits, such as extending the lifespan of the lighting fixtures and improving the overall lighting environment within the warehouse.
